Intarsia Colorwork Knitting In The Round with Sylvia Watts-Cherry
Description

Learn how to knit intarsia in the round and make a seamless, stripes and hearts pattern drawstring bag that you can fill with gorgeous goodies to gift for Galenstine or to keep for yourself. Plus, learn tips for keeping your yarns organised, maintaining your tension, calculating yarn needs and more.

Class Supplies:

• Fingering/Light DK weight yarn in a main color (MC) plus at up to 4 contrasting colours (CC) as follows: Main color: 20g; Contrast Colors: 10-20g total in up to 4 colors
• Gauge-size needle(s) of your preferred type for working small circumferences (40cm (16”) circular for magic loop recommended)
• Tapestry needle
• Scissors
• Ruler

Homework

Using gauge-size needle and your preferred cast-on method, cast on 58 stitches with Main Colour (MC). Place a marker to mark the beginning of round. Be careful not to twist the yarn, join to work in the round. Knit 4 rounds in MC then stripe next 16 rounds as follows:
Round 5: Knit using first contrast colour (CC1)
Round 6: Purl using CC1
Rounds 7-9: Knit using MC
Round 10: Knit using second contrast colour (CC2)
Round 11: Purl using CC2
Rounds 12-14: Knit using MC
Round 15: Knit using third contrast colour (CC3)
Round 16: Purl using CC3
Rounds 17-20: Knit using MC
